Abstract
The present invention relates to material transportation technical fields, disclose the docking structure of AGV trolleies and shelf.Docking structure provided by the invention includes AGV trolleies and shelf, and shelf are equipped with docking section, and AGV trolleies are equipped with the socket part being adapted to the docking section, and docking section is set to above socket part;Docking section or socket part are equipped with pushing structure, and pushing structure is used to fasten docking section and socket part.Present invention mainly solves high frequencies to dock under scene, and problem is considered in the friction that the friction loss of docking structure is brought to be worth doing, including avoids generating the collection for the bits that rub that friction is considered to be worth doing and generated;Opposite friction can be reduced simultaneously, reduce the generation of metal fillings as far as possible.In addition the metal fillings generated is fully collected, no risk for entering car body.

Specific implementation mode
In the following, in conjunction with attached drawing and specific implementation mode, the present invention is described further, it should be noted that not
Under the premise of conflicting, new implementation can be formed between various embodiments described below or between each technical characteristic in any combination
Example.
As shown in Figure 1, Figure 2, Figure 3 shows, a kind of docking structure of AGV trolleies and shelf, including AGV trolleies 4 and shelf 1, goods
Frame 1 is equipped with docking section 2, and AGV trolleies 4 are equipped with the socket part 3 being adapted to docking section 2, and docking section 2 is set to the socket part 3
Top;Shelf 1 or AGV trolleies 4 are equipped with pushing structure, and pushing structure is for fastening docking section 2 and socket part 3.
Docking structure further includes anti-attrition part, and anti-attrition part is set on the docking section 2 or the socket part 3, and anti-attrition part is used for
Reduce the abrasion of the docking structure.In the docking of the high frequency time of docking structure, docking structure is easy to wear, while being easy production
Raw metal fillings;Therefore, anti-attrition part is set on docking section 2 or socket part 3, greatly reduces abrasion and the metal of docking structure
The generation of bits extends the service life of docking structure, need not frequent more preferable docking structure, only need to change anti-attrition part i.e.
It can.
Docking structure further includes docking correction unit, and the docking correction unit is set to the docking section 2 or the socket part 3
On, the docking correction unit is used to improve the docking success rate of the docking structure.In the docking operation of docking structure, docking
Portion 2 and the application position required precision of socket part 3 docked to AGV trolleies 4 are higher, when AGV trolleies 4 and shelf 1 have it is opposite
When site error or angular error, it may dock and fail;Therefore, the setting docking correction on docking section 2 or socket part 3
Portion can reduce the requirement to 4 application position precision of AGV trolleies, right when site error or angular error occurs in docking
It connects correction unit docking structure can be corrected in docking operation, improves docking success rate.
Docking section 2 includes buttcover plate 22 and the docking column 21 being connect with the buttcover plate 22, and buttcover plate 22 connects with shelf 1
It connects;Socket part 3 includes butt muff 31 and the receiver 32 that connect with butt muff 31, butt muff 31 by receiver 32 and
AGV trolleies 4 connect.Butt muff 31 is located on the AGV trolleies 4 close to lower position, is facilitated to receive and is generated in docking operation
Metal fillings.
Anti-attrition part is anti-attrition sleeve 6, and the adaptation of anti-attrition sleeve 6 is set in butt muff 31.Anti-attrition sleeve 6 can be gold
Belong to anti-attrition sleeve 6, plays the role of reducing abrasion, extend docking structure service life;Or such as rubber is nonmetallic soft
Property material, can play reduce abrasion while, reduce docking operation in metal fillings generation.Anti-attrition sleeve 6 can also be socketed
In 21 outside of docking column, can serve the same role.
It is that the back taper set on 31 open end of butt muff is open to dock correction unit.Butt muff 31 is open for back taper,
Play the purpose for facilitating docking.In the case where docking structure is equipped with anti-attrition sleeve 6, docking correction unit is set on anti-attrition sleeve 6
The back taper of open end is open.Anti-attrition sleeve 6 is open for back taper, the butt muff 31 being adapted to accordingly with anti-attrition sleeve 6
It can be that back taper is open, play the purpose for facilitating docking.Docking correction unit can also be located on docking column 21, will dock column 21
Lower end be set as tip as docking correction unit, can play the same role.
It docks column 21 to be inserted into butt muff 31, completes the docking of shelf 1 and AGV trolleies 4, shelf 1 can be with later
The movement of AGV trolleies 4 and move, i.e. AGV trolleies transport is placed on material on shelf 1.
Anti-attrition sleeve 6 is packed into inside butt muff 8, and anti-attrition sleeve 6 is made of the material reducing friction, and shape is designed as
Back taper is, it can be achieved that reduce the purpose that merging precision requires, when AGV trolleies 4 and shelf 1 have opposite site error or angle
It can be corrected in docking operation when error.The significantly less generation of abrasion and metal fillings of the use of anti-attrition sleeve 6, prolongs
Docking structure service life has been grown, cost has greatly been saved in the application scenarios of high frequency docking.In addition the tubular of anti-attrition sleeve 6
Design, bottom are blind hole structure, practical application scene can be facilitated to the clear of friction bits by friction bits centralized collection in cylinder
Reason.After service life expires, the lower anti-attrition sleeve 6 of replacement cost also reduces scheme cost.
Pushing structure can be arranged between AGV trolleies 4 and socket part 3, and socket part 3 is pushed to move up, and realize docking
The docking of structure;Pushing structure can also be arranged between shelf 1 and docking section 2, push docking section 2 to decline, make docking column 21
It is docked with butt muff 31.Pushing structure can be general hydraulically extensible cylinder and other can realize the mechanism of pushing function.
